Output 53b205bae294861a288902463fa42a421c94edbe116a4a258409e49d8bb4de27:2

value
364000
script pubkey
OP_0 OP_PUSHBYTES_20 bfd956c132716176e7bf26fadbf4e16854194cdb
address
bc1qhlv4dsfjw9shdealymadha8pdp2pjnxmcxpddg
transaction
53b205bae294861a288902463fa42a421c94edbe116a4a258409e49d8bb4de27
confirmations
113549
spent
true